Job Summary

Adrenaline Attractions is seeking a skilled Scenic Fabricator to join our fabrication team. This role supports the build and finish of immersive themed-entertainment environments, props, façades, sculptural elements, and custom scenic installations.

We are specifically seeking a candidate with substantial hands-on experience in fiberglass composites, resin casting, mold making, and tooling. The ideal candidate can take a project from drawings, models, or design intent through fabrication, finishing, and installation-ready delivery while maintaining high standards for craftsmanship, safety, and quality.

Responsibilities

  • Fabricate scenic elements in collaboration with fabricators, sculptors, painters, carpenters, and project leads.

  • Build, prepare, and maintain molds, tooling, patterns, armatures, bucks, and forms.

  • Perform fiberglass layup using mat, cloth, resin, gelcoat, fillers, and related composite materials.

  • Mix, tint, pour, cast, laminate, trim, sand, repair, and finish fiberglass and resin components.

  • Create and use silicone, urethane, plaster, fiberglass, and rigid “mother” molds as appropriate to the project.

  • Understand mold construction details such as parting lines, keys, flanges, release systems, reinforcement, and demolding.

  • Work with urethane, epoxy, polyester, and other casting or laminating resins according to product specifications.

  • Complete surface preparation, bodywork, sanding, shaping, patching, and finish-ready detailing.

  • Assist with CNC, 3D printing, foam shaping, sculpting, woodworking, and other fabrication processes as needed.

  • Follow drawings, shop instructions, material specifications, and established fabrication best practices.

  • Maintain an organized, safe workspace; use appropriate PPE, ventilation, and safe handling procedures for resins, fiberglass, dust, and solvents.

  • Track project time accurately using company software.

  • Communicate clearly, take direction effectively, and work collaboratively in a fast-paced shop environment.

  • Support overtime, changing project priorities, and occasional installation needs as required.

Required Qualifications

  • Significant practical experience with fiberglass fabrication, composite layup, resin work, casting, mold making, or related scenic fabrication.

  • Working knowledge of fiberglass mat and cloth, gelcoat, resin mixing, cure times, release agents, and finishing techniques.

  • Experience building or using molds for production casting, including silicone, urethane, plaster, fiberglass, or rigid molds.

  • Experience with surface finishing, sanding, trimming, grinding, patching, and repair of fiberglass or resin parts.

  • Ability to read shop drawings, dimensions, templates, and fabrication instructions.

  • Strong attention to detail, craftsmanship, problem-solving, and quality control.

  • Excellent communication skills and the ability to work well within a team.

  • Ability to safely lift, move, and work with fabrication materials and tools.

Preferred Qualifications

  • Experience in themed entertainment, film, television, museum exhibits, event fabrication, theater, or scenic shops.

  • Woodworking, scenic carpentry, sculpting, or scenic-painting experience.

  • CNC routing, 3D printing, digital fabrication, and foam shaping experience.

  • Experience with vacuum bagging, composite repair, or advanced fiberglass tooling.

  • Experience creating positive forms, master patterns, hard coats, and production molds.

  • Familiarity with urethane foam, rigid foam, EPS/XPS foam, clay, plaster, epoxy, and specialty coatings.

  • Experience with spray applications, color matching, texture work, and final scenic finishes.

  • Forklift, aerial lift, or other relevant shop-equipment certifications.

Compensation: $20.00 - $28.00 per hour
